Laser veins removal: bigger blue (dark) veins as side effects ? Will it disappear? (Photo)

December 6, 2015
Asked By:LucieOttawa in Ottawa, ON

Two weeks ago I had a laser spider veins removal on my legs. But some blue/black lines appeared after that (some veins that have been treated), and they don't go away. Is it normal ? Will it disappear with time ? I'm really worried because it's worst than before ! The big blue one is the worst. We can clearly see it just by looking quickly to my legs. On pictures it's the same leg but with different lightening.
